rpms/pyroom/devel pyroom-locale.patch, NONE, 1.1 .cvsignore, 1.4, 1.5 pyroom.spec, 1.8, 1.9 sources, 1.4, 1.5 pyroom.desktop-patch, 1.2, NONE

Sven Lankes slankes at fedoraproject.org
Sat Apr 4 18:37:25 UTC 2009


Author: slankes

Update of /cvs/pkgs/rpms/pyroom/devel
In directory cvs1.fedora.phx.redhat.com:/tmp/cvs-serv9966

Modified Files:
	.cvsignore pyroom.spec sources 
Added Files:
	pyroom-locale.patch 
Removed Files:
	pyroom.desktop-patch 
Log Message:
new upstream release, drop desktop patch, add locale-patch

pyroom-locale.patch:

--- NEW FILE pyroom-locale.patch ---
=== modified file 'setup.py'
--- old/setup.py	2009-03-26 14:07:49.000000000 +0100
+++ new/setup.py	2009-04-04 20:14:41.000000000 +0200
@@ -34,8 +34,11 @@
     
     def find_mo_files(self):
         data_files = []
-        for mo in glob.glob(os.path.join(MO_DIR, '*', 'pyroom.mo')):
+        for mo in glob.glob(os.path.join(MO_DIR, '*', 'LC_MESSAGES', 'pyroom.mo')):
             lang = os.path.basename(os.path.dirname(mo))
+            lang = os.path.basename(
+                os.path.realpath(os.path.join(os.path.dirname(mo), '..'))
+            )
             dest = os.path.join('share', 'locale', lang, 'LC_MESSAGES')
             data_files.append((dest, [mo]))
         return data_files


Index: .cvsignore
===================================================================
RCS file: /cvs/pkgs/rpms/pyroom/devel/.cvsignore,v
retrieving revision 1.4
retrieving revision 1.5
diff -u -r1.4 -r1.5
--- .cvsignore	6 Dec 2008 21:39:02 -0000	1.4
+++ .cvsignore	4 Apr 2009 18:36:54 -0000	1.5
@@ -1 +1 @@
-pyroom-0.3.2.tar.gz
+pyroom-0.4.1.tar.gz


Index: pyroom.spec
===================================================================
RCS file: /cvs/pkgs/rpms/pyroom/devel/pyroom.spec,v
retrieving revision 1.8
retrieving revision 1.9
diff -u -r1.8 -r1.9
--- pyroom.spec	26 Feb 2009 20:22:29 -0000	1.8
+++ pyroom.spec	4 Apr 2009 18:36:54 -0000	1.9
@@ -1,15 +1,15 @@
 %{!?python_sitelib: %define python_sitelib %(%{__python} -c "from distutils.sysconfig import get_python_lib; print get_python_lib()")}
 
 Name:           pyroom
-Version:        0.3.2
-Release:        2%{?dist}
+Version:        0.4.1
+Release:        1%{?dist}
 Summary:        PyRoom is a full screen text editor and a clone of Writeroom
 
 Group:          Applications/Editors
 License:        GPLv3+
 URL:            http://pyroom.org/ 
 Source0:        http://launchpad.net/pyroom/0.3/0.3.2/+download/%{name}-%{version}.tar.gz
-Patch0:         pyroom.desktop-patch
+Patch0:         pyroom-locale.patch
 BuildRoot:      %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
 
 BuildArch:      noarch 
@@ -18,7 +18,9 @@
 Requires:       pyxdg
 Requires:       gnome-python2-gtksourceview
 BuildRequires:  python-devel
+BuildRequires:  pygtk2
 BuildRequires:  desktop-file-utils
+BuildRequires:  gettext
 
 %description
 
@@ -28,14 +30,15 @@
 
 %prep
 %setup -q
-%patch0 -p0
+%patch0 -p1
 
 %build
 %{__python} setup.py build
 
 %install
 rm -rf $RPM_BUILD_ROOT
-%{__python} setup.py install --skip-build --root $RPM_BUILD_ROOT
+# %{__python} setup.py install --skip-build --root $RPM_BUILD_ROOT
+%{__python} setup.py install --root $RPM_BUILD_ROOT
 chmod 755 %{buildroot}/%{python_sitelib}/PyRoom/cmdline.py
 
 desktop-file-install --vendor=""    \
@@ -44,10 +47,12 @@
 gzip pyroom.1
 install -p -D %{name}.1.gz %{buildroot}/%{_mandir}/man1/%{name}.1.gz
 
+%find_lang %{name}
+
 %clean
 rm -rf $RPM_BUILD_ROOT
 
-%files 
+%files -f %{name}.lang
 %defattr(-,root,root,-)
 %doc AUTHORS LICENSE README
 %{python_sitelib}/*
@@ -57,6 +62,11 @@
 %{_mandir}/man1/%{name}.1.gz
 
 %changelog
+* Wed Mar 25 2009 Sven Lankes <sven at lank.es> - 0.4.1-1
+- new upstream release
+- remove desktop-file-patch
+- add patch to fix mo-file install (patch received from upstream)
+
 * Thu Feb 26 2009 Fedora Release Engineering <rel-eng at lists.fedoraproject.org> - 0.3.2-2
 - Rebuilt for https://fedoraproject.org/wiki/Fedora_11_Mass_Rebuild
 


Index: sources
===================================================================
RCS file: /cvs/pkgs/rpms/pyroom/devel/sources,v
retrieving revision 1.4
retrieving revision 1.5
diff -u -r1.4 -r1.5
--- sources	6 Dec 2008 21:39:02 -0000	1.4
+++ sources	4 Apr 2009 18:36:54 -0000	1.5
@@ -1 +1 @@
-288d7d5a9853fe38201eec1dec12866d  pyroom-0.3.2.tar.gz
+af33f0713b5cd47c90e5b9747e537a18  pyroom-0.4.1.tar.gz


--- pyroom.desktop-patch DELETED ---




More information about the fedora-extras-commits mailing list